The Farm Service Agency is reporting the below values for Chattooga County at this point:
Corn- 1556.23; Cotton Upland-316.54; Crops – 75.6; Home Garden-2.09; Grass – 2842.47; Millet- 2.23; Mixed Forage -6812.74; Soybean – 1543.15; Trees and Timber- 75.38; Wheat- 334.38; Wildlife food plot- 4.01; With a grand total sum of report acres for Chattooga County- 13564.82.
Chattooga county timber values reported from the GA Department of Revenue is $829,009.
